MXL1013MJ8 is a Linear - Amplifiers - Instrumentation, OP Amps, Buffer Amps manufactured by Analog Devices Inc./Maxim Integrated. IC OPAMP GP 2 CIRCUIT 8CERDIP. Key specifications: mounting type Through Hole, operating temperature -55°C ~ 125°C, package / case 8-CDIP (0.300", 7.62mm), current - supply 350µA (x2 Channels).
